Kerri's bag side one
I hosted a baggie swap for the third (or 4th) time last year. Members of the group exchanged squishies of fabrics and embellishments and each person made something from the bag they received and then it was returned to the original owner. Kerri was very patient and gave me time to finish so I hope she likes it. I thought she deserves something special for all her patience and all the cool crazy quilts she shares from eBay!

Roomie Block for Omaha Crazy Quilt
Each year a group of us share a room at the Crazy Quilt Retreat in Omaha. There is an auction for which we each make a block that goes into a crazyquilt that is auctioned off for ACS and for scholarships to the retreat. Kate pieces the blocks and sends them to us to embellish. This was my block!
